Scar Revision

The vast majority of scarring that we manage is usually located on the face. Most cases are secondary to trauma such as auto accidents or animal attacks, but many patients seek improvement following the scarring caused by acne. These scars can’t be totally removed however most scars can be improved to the point of being almost nondetectable.

In the vast majority of cases this is an outpatient procedure done under a local I.V. sedation anesthetic and can usually be performed in our office operative suite. In some cases, because of functional problems associated with the scarring, insurance can be helpful in the costs of these procedures.

Recovery time:

Sutures are removed 6-8 days after surgery. The scar will gradually fade over the next 6 months and approximately 20-25% of our patients request a small laser resurfacing in order to enhance the overall result.
